Kohima, May 31 (EMN): Team Amplified emerged champion of the 2nd Men’s Open Basketball Trophy after defeating Stallions 87-73, on May 31.
The trophy was organised by Oriental College Kohima within the college premises at Seikhazou, D Khel Kohima village.
Team Amplified received a cash award of INR 30,000 while the runners-up Stallions received INR 15,000, both with trophies and citations.
Mhaphrouvikuo Kire of Amplified was adjudged the most valuable player of the tournament.
Principal of Oriental College, Kohima, Dr.Ketshukietuo Dzuvichü handed over the awards to the winners in the presence of vice principal Gopal Basnet and convenor, organising committee Ruokuovituo Zatsu. Keviuchütuo Kuotsu delivered the vote of thanks.
